Description
Architect-Engineering (A-E) services are required for design of miscellaneous operation and maintenance projects and supporting services at Minot AFB, ND. An open-ended contract will be issued for a period of 1 year with option to renew for 1 year. Projects will be issued to the contractor in the form of work orders. Work orders will not exceed $299,000 in fees. Cumulative amounts will not exceed $750,000 in fees per year. Work orders will be issued from time to time as need arises during the contract period. Design services required will be in conjunction with minor remodeling and maintenance type projects, including preparation of drawings and specifications. Various types of A-E services such as investigations, inspections, studies, reports, and cost estimates may also be required as relates to project design. A minimum of $5,000 in fee work will be issued under the contract; a firm-fixed price A-E (Indefinite Delivery) contract will be used. Significant evaluation factors in of relative importance are as follows: (A.) Professional qualifications necessary for satisfactory performance of required services. (B.) Specialized experience and technical competence in the type of work required. (C.) Capacity to accomplish the work in the required time. (D.) Past performance on contract with government agencies and private industry in terms of cost control, quality of work, and compliance with performance schedules. (E.) Location in the general geographical area of the project and knowledge of the locality of the project; provided that application of this criterion leaves an appropriate number of qualified firms, given the nature and size of project. (F). Acceptability under other appropriate evaluation criteria. Firms desiring consideration shall submit a completed form 254 and 255 no later than the close of business on 26 January 2004 in order to be considered. Cover letters and unnecessarily elaborate brochures, or other presentations beyond those sufficient to present a complete response are not desired. Submital by fax will not be considered. The proposed acquisition listed herin is open to both large and small business concerns. This is not a request for proposals. More than one contract may be issued as a result of this synopsis. NAICS code for this action is 541310.
